Choosing the Right Line Set for Your Mini-Split System
Installing a mini-split system can be a smart choice for your home. But before you get started, it's essential to pick the right line set. The line set is the pipeline between your indoor and outdoor units, and it plays a crucial role in the system's efficiency. A properly sized line set will ensure that your mini-split works at its best, providing comfortable temperatures and saving you money on energy bills.
- When picking a line set, consider the distance between your indoor and outdoor units.
- Greater distances may require larger diameter tubing to reduce pressure loss.
- Don't forget to factor in the size of your mini-split unit. A larger unit will demand a heavier-duty line set.
Consulting with a qualified HVAC professional can help you figure out the best line set for your specific needs. They can evaluate your home and system requirements to suggest the ideal solution.
